    Though not official, Spanish has a special status in the American state of New Mexico. With almost 60 million native speakers and second language speakers, the United States now has the second largest Spanish-speaking population in the world after Mexico.     • Spanish is the native language of 12% of the US population. Almost 43 million US citizens reportedly speak Spanish as their first language. It is also the most popular second language to learn. This means more Spanish speakers live in the US than in Spain. The USA has the second largest Spanish speaking population in the world (after Mexico). There...
